I was checking a couple of days ago my flight leaves 12 hours after I need to check out of my hotel. The left luggage kiosks on the fourth and second floor of the airport were closed. However there are facilities on the B level, where you catch the trains. There are two or three down the left hand side of the hall as you look with your back to the airport entrance. Prices were 100 Baht but it was on a per day basis so may not be suitable for anything over a day.

3 hours ago, LookingTurnsInto said:

Just did a search around for some place for a few months and REDD seemed like a good option. You've had a good experience I assume given you keep using them?

yep, no serious issues. some small annoyances like being asked for documents after a couple years and no longer having a webpage to complete renewals, when I log in I don't see my booking. But email them and they get back to you with a payment option and documentation of reservation. I think they changed management during covid and new person seems a bit daft. would still recommend tho.
